Thune and the Port Authority Quietly Neuter Walkability on Saint Paul’s West Side
https://streets.mn/2015/06/03/thune-and- ... west-side/
Editor’s note: In an effort to bring this time-sensitive news to a broader audience, here’s a quick summary:

Last minute amendments added to a plan to revitalize the West Side flats, a large underused area next to downtown Saint Paul, threaten to strip walkability and green space from the neighborhood while undermining a lengthy community process. In trying to protect existing businesses, the amendments strip out reconnected street grid, efforts to reduce surface parking, and walkable street designs from the Eastern half of the plan area. The public hearing is this afternoon, and a decision by the City Council is expected next week.
